Introduction Bart Bjorkman is primarily a "people" tracker for search and rescue and law enforcement - although he has been known to track anything that moves. His initial training was through Universal Tracking Services where he achieved the highest level of training - "Sign Cutter". Formerly an instructor for the Justice Institute of British Columbia training search and rescue members in the art of tracking, Bjorkman was the Director of Training for the British Columbia Tracking Association Society (BCTA) where he previously served as a regional director, vice president and chairman of the training standards committee. Bjorkman authored the training manual used by the BCTA for "track aware" training as well as the manuals used by Northern Tracker for search and rescue and military tracker training. Featured with fellow tracker "Darcy Fear" on the television series "Call Out", Bjorkman has tracked from the tundra of the High Arctic to the jungles of Central America. A college diploma in Criminal Justice and a certificate in Forensic Science from Ashworth University compliments a lifetime of backcountry experience and military service in the Canadian Special Services Force.
